Toy Soldiers has a new album, The Maybe Boys, coming out Sept. 10. The A.V. Club has the exclusive premiere of the band's single "Red Dress." It's an upbeat track with a rockabilly-esque sound that could elicit some serious toe tapping. Slower verses are sprinkled in a couple of places, but "Red Dress" is a true practice in some sort of speed country. Toy Soldiers will be on tour for the next couple of months in support of The Maybe Boys, and those dates are below.
